Last day of the at MCR Met Racing! Last but most certainly not least is our diff plate designed by Ross Taylor

The diff plate is a rear bulkhead used to close out the rear of the chassis and to mount the rear suspension, differential, engine mounts, etc.
This design aims to increase the flexibility of mounting the components on the rear of the car and improve on aesthetics. This design brings with it a reduction in mass over the equivalent steel tubes, brackets and weld material with it being made from high grade Aluminium.

day 5 and today we're celebrating Sajjad Bahmani Sangesari 's 3D printed plenum design.

Its 400 grams lighter and doesn't wobble like the previous carbon fibre one which means it's more reliable and it won't implode. We wanted to feed more air into the engine despite rule restrictions, which was the main objective as well as reach high torque at 7300 rpm.

We faced difficulties faced like the limitation of the space we had due to surface envelope restrictions. We created our own cobra head design which is an efficient way to overcome 90 bends flow failures.

The design benefited from Fluid CFD simulations, static FEA SolidWorks simulations as well as Wave tuning Kelvin Helmholtz resonance calculations.

On day 4 of MCR Met Racing's we're looking at the suspension, designed by Polina Ozz

Fortuna had a light weight tubular wishbone design, featuring adjustable camber on the rear to improve performance in different dynamic events. Both front and rear suspensions were equipped with anti-roll bars with multiple adjustable stiffness settings to improve handling on track.

Day 3 of the and we're taking a look at Fortuna's steering rack designed by Leo Batty!

We use a rack and pinion for steering actuation. The rack housing was designed and manufactured in-house from aluminium and carbon-fibre, providing a weight saving of 40% compared with the previous years purchased system.
This year we are looking into new manufacturing techniques for the housing. 3D printing is less energy intensive and can help us to save on cost.

Today on the we're looking at MCR MET Racing's first aerodynamic package, focusing on the rear wing designed by Ruben Lally

The main benefit of our aerodynamics package is that it produces down force which improves the cornering capability of the car at higher speeds.
The aerodynamics package was manufactured entirely in house and consists of a front and rear wing. Both the front and rear wing feature duel element aerofoil designs. Each aerofoil is constructed from carbon fibre with a foam core.
To improve the performance of the aerodynamics package this year will be producing a diffuser. The diffuser is very efficient and expected to generate 40% of the car’s total downforce, so it will have a significant impact on the cornering performance. We are also aiming to reduce the mass of the aerodynamics package by manufacturing hollow carbon fibre aerofoils and carbon fibre end plates.

This January, MCR Met Racing is taking part in the ! 7 days, 7 photos of nothing but close-up parts of the car. This time we will be focusing on Fortuna, our FS2019 car that gained us 17th place in FSUK and 12th place at FSN. Take a look at our excellent designs, starting with our wheels, designed by Tom Morley

The centre-less wheel design used on the car is a part consolidation of the hub, lug nuts and wheel centre. The main reason for this design is to reduce the number of components and reduce the mass on the unsprung side of the vehicle. A reduction of 1 kg of unsprung mass is said to be equivalent to 4 kg of sprung mass, making it a desirable area to shed weight. Less mass on the suspension side of the vehicle improves the dynamic capabilities of the car.
The design resulted in a 22% and 19%, front and rear respectively, mass reduction and allowed for an increase in wheel diameter from 10” to 13”.
This year research into the use of 3D printing will be conducted to further reduce the mass of the wheels. The method of manufacturing will be Fused Filament Fabrication (FFF) with the aim to reduce infill density in areas where stress are less.
